Happy to say that much of this I was familiar with due solely to reading in this forum. Previous to owning a FiST and lurking around here, I had no clue about any details of fuel injection. It was just a buzzword in a car commercial.

Anyways, was interesting to watch and I did still learn a good deal. This isn't specific to FiSTs, but does explain direct injection and the problems we can run into due to the lack of port injection to keep the valves clean.

One of his better videos...thanks for posting. In my experience, nothing completely prevents the carbon buildup on GDI motors. Catch cans, top tier fuel, and the dubious "Italian tune up" won't clean you intake ports/valves. And worse, the cleaning service is not covered under warranty.
